Graduate Classical Languages & Literature Degrees at William & Mary

The following degree levels are offered in classical languages & literature at William & Mary, along with how many graduates complete each level annually.

Degree Level Annual Graduates
Bachelor’s 20
Graduate Certificate 3

William & Mary Classical Languages & Literature Graduate Certificate Degrees

In the most recent year for which we have data, William & Mary handed out 3 graduate certificate degrees in classical languages & literature.

William & Mary Graduate Tuition and Fees

$43,857 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

The full-time graduate tuition and fees are shown below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$36,742 $58,353
Fees $7,115 $7,686
